30 THOMAS GIBSON DRIVE is a small detached house of 89m², built sometime between 1996 and 2002. It was last sold for £170,000 in March 2019, which was around 26% below the average March 2019 detached price in the East Lindsey local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was January 2016, where the current energy rating was D, and the potential energy rating was B.

30 THOMAS GIBSON DRIVE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the East Lindsey local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two 30 THOMAS GIBSON DRIVE sales from November 2000 and March 2019 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the November 2000 sale was for 1%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 1% above the HPI over time, until the March 2019 sale, where it falls to 26%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 26% below the HPI.

What might 30 THOMAS GIBSON DRIVE be worth now?

30 THOMAS GIBSON DRIVE might now be worth an estimated £210,305.

This is based on house price inflation of 23.7%, between March 2019 and December 2024, for detached houses, in the East Lindsey local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 23.7%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 30 THOMAS GIBSON DRIVE of £170,000 on 1st March 2019. For the value to have increased from £170,000 to £210,305 over the four years and three months to December 2024,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 30 THOMAS GIBSON DRIVE has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the East Lindsey local authority area.
  • The March 2019 sale price of £170,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 30 THOMAS GIBSON DRIVE has not materially changed since March 2019.
